Welcome to the QRISK ® 3 risk calculator. This site calculates a person's risk of developing a heart attack or stroke over the next 10 years, producing the score described in this academic paper: Development and validation of QRISK3 risk prediction algorithms to estimate future risk of cardiovascular disease: prospective cohort study, BMJ 2017 ...

Jun 2, 2021 · Results: From the 115 selected articles, 38 different fall risk assessment tools were identified, divided into two groups: the first with the main tools present in the literature, and the second represented by tools of some specific areas, of lesser use and with less supporting literature.
